Font Size: a A A

Research And Application Of Data Sharing And Exchange Platform Based On Blockchain

Posted on:2022-03-07Degree:MasterType:Thesis
Country:ChinaCandidate:F RanFull Text:PDF
GTID:2518306524989909Subject:Master of Engineering
Abstract/Summary:PDF Full Text Request
With computer science and technology developing increasingly,while people’s quality of life has improved,the amount of data generated every day is also increasing at an exponential rate.In the era of data explosion,the potential value of data has been given careful attention to gradually with the emergence and rapid development of the technologies such as artificial intelligence and big data.Opinions on Building a Better System and Mechanism for Market-based Allocation of Factors of Production,the regulation promulgated by the Communist Party of China and the State Council in March 2020,have included data in the category of factors of production.So it can be seen that data has received the highest recognition at the national level.However,if we wish to get the full value of data,sharing is the future trend.In this thesis,we design and implement a platform for sharing and exchanging data based on block chain technology.With the use of bringing the code to the data and the help of the features of blockchain such as open and transparent,immutable and so forth,we realize the safe sharing of data on the premise that data is still in local.In our platform,the data provider,as a platform user,connects data to platform through the deployed and maintained data node.The code consumes data with controlled in a safe and trusted environment after being deployed to our platform through the capabilities provided by the platform.Data is within the control of the data provider in the whole process,and then the goal of sharing data safely is thus achieved.The main research works includes: Design from the two aspects of networking architecture and software architecture,and divide the software into several fine-grained modules.Finally,we’ll implement the platform on this basis.Test the implemented platform from the aspects of function and performance,and analyze the results of testing;Summarize our research works,and propose the defects to be improved.
Keywords/Search Tags:blockchain, smart contract, data sharing, data security
PDF Full Text Request
Related items